Restore-ServiceBinary

SYNOPSIS

Restores a service binary backed up by Install-ServiceBinary.

Author: Will Schroeder (@harmj0y)
License: BSD 3-Clause
Required Dependencies: Get-ServiceDetail, Get-ModifiablePath

SYNTAX

Restore-ServiceBinary [-Name] <String> [[-BackupPath] <String>]

DESCRIPTION

Takes a service Name or a ServiceProcess.ServiceController on the pipeline and checks for the existence of an "OriginalServiceBinary.exe.bak" in the service binary location. If it exists, the backup binary is restored to the original binary path.

EXAMPLES

-------------------------- EXAMPLE 1 --------------------------

Restore-ServiceBinary -Name VulnSVC

Restore the original binary for the service 'VulnSVC'.

-------------------------- EXAMPLE 2 --------------------------

Get-Service VulnSVC | Restore-ServiceBinary

Restore the original binary for the service 'VulnSVC'.

-------------------------- EXAMPLE 3 --------------------------

Restore-ServiceBinary -Name VulnSVC -BackupPath 'C:\temp\backup.exe'

Restore the original binary for the service 'VulnSVC' from a custom location.
